round, using different methods. My scientific work began with an exhibition of
Cy Twombly at Berne in Switzerland, back in 1974. The catalogue mentioned
Leonardo da Vinci's drawings of water, and so I lent a Leonardo monograph from
my library. I remember well spending half an hour looking at John the Baptist
without understanding anything at all. Half a year later, absolving an art
school, I began carrying out visual experiments, in the course of which I
discovered the same effect Margaret Livingstone, neurologist of Harvard, has
rediscovered and published recently: a certain flicker of the lips of the Mona
Lisa when one moves ones look over her face. Look on her lips, and she is
hardly smiling. Look into her eyes (into her left eye in the center of the
circle of her head) and you can't see her lips clearly anymore, the corners of
her mouth and shadows of her cheeks are joining, we can't really see the
corners of her mouth any longer, but we sure know they are there, and so we
project them somewhere into the shadowy region where they can be expected,
however, misguided by clever Leonardo, who said that only the central rays of
vision are true and strong, all others weak and deceptive (debole e bugiarde)
we place the corners of her mouth a little beside the actual corners and above
them, what results in a smile, and if we are surprised by her smile and smile
in return, she will unfold her true and loving smile ... My discovery led me to
a complete interpretation of the Mona Lisa as an Allegory of Seeing, and the
Mona Lisa made me understand John the Baptist: this one must be Leonardo's
alter ego as a painter, symbolizing his career from a pupil of Andrea del
Verrocchio (left angel in this ones and Leonardo's Baptism of Christ) via his
initiation as a master of the fine arts (young John entering the grotto of the
Madonna of the Rocks) and his remembering of the early days (replica of the
Madonna of the Rocks, where Leonardo is present in the way the angel is looking
over to young John/Leonardo) to his final work, namely John the Baptist, where
Leonardo is speaking in the Italian manner, using his hands: "God created
the world [raised arm, brilliant right hand]; I, Leonardo, once born in his
world, have seen it. Much of what I have seen [eyes] and studied [front of the
head] found its way into my work [left hand]. However, my work is incomplete
and only a weak reflex of the beauty of Nature, God's work. - My dear pupils,
friends and followers, I will soon leave you. The black shadows behind me are
already enveloping my half naked body. What are the dark veils hiding? You may
see or merely guess a hint of a bush and eventually some hills or mountains,
but as soon as this happens the space is closing in and you are again
confronted with the black wall no one can see through. I am already half taken
by the darkness, and sooner or later I shall be gone. But don't be sad, and if
you loose a great artist, study the work of a far greater one - study Nature,
God's work that surpasses all human works.

Consider again the case of the Mona Lisa. The original format was 4x3 units,
one unit given by the vertical measurement of the head on the level of the
eyes, more precisely on the height of the small bending of the veil. Add one
unit to the left and one to the right of the hair, and you obtain the original
width of the painting, while the left line of the balustrade marks the 2/3
height (1.6 plus 2.4 units). Now draw the large middle circle (radius 1.5
units); it will seize the bow of the hair of the Mona Lisa. Then draw arcs of
the radii 4 units around the corners of the original format 4:3. The arcs will touch
the circle in the same points wherein the long diagonals (5 units) cross the
circle. The arcs around the lower corners touch the woman's head. Now draw
circles around the four points, wherein the large circle, the diagonals and the
arcs meet and cross, and let the radii measure 0.1, 0.2, 0.3, 0.4 ... units or
1, 2, 3, 4 ... small units. The resulting waves explain both the figure of the
woman and the shifting of the landscape. As if Leonardo anticipated the
physical double nature of matter and wave ... Moreover, four circles meet in a
mathematically very close double point on a height of 35 small units (half a
unit below the frame), and this close double point is marked by a special
iconographic point, namely by the begin of the parting of the woman's hair,
hence a point on the front of her head, symbol for the mind, relating seeing
(activity of the eyes) with reasoning (activity of the mind).

For example I can show that the Getty Kouros is
a) an original, and b) related both with the Kouros from Tenea (kept at Munich)
and the Kroisos from Anavyssos (National Museum Athens.) I even dare say that
we may speak of Master A and B: Master A was the creator of the Kouros from
Tenea and the teacher of Master B, who created the Getty Kouros as a juvenile
masterwork, with an almost lyrical quality to the lines, and the Kroisos from
Anavyssos on the summit of his career, making use of a fully developed and
proudly unfolded geometry. The school of Master A and Master B may also have
produced the unknown master of the wonderful Poseidon from Cape Artemision. In
this bronze statue I found another geometry worth of the Greek mind, displaying
the artistic principles of measure and rhythm (articulating a composition), of
symmetry and a-symmetry (holding a composition together and bringing it to
life), and self-reference (the equivalent to autopoiesis in biology). Furthermore, and most rewarding in my
opinion, are geometrical reconstructions, for example the ones of the formerly
shorter saloon of the Villa Farnesina at Rome and its picture program. One of
my results: Leonardo's famous drawing of Neptune and his four sea-horses was
originally planned as a wall-painting for the saloon of Agostino Chigi's villa,
and so was Raphael's Galatea (the original format of which having been a square).
Another reconstruction regards a pair of hypothetical Leonardo wall-paintings
in the Belvedere of the Vatican (former audience room, today's parrot chamber
in the Museum): John the Baptist on one bank of the River Lete, and the Nymph
on the opposite bank. If you pass the hypothetical wall-paintings from the side
(following the gangway) you will observe another amazing optical illusion:
John, pointing beyond his shoulder, is now pointing toward the side of the
Nymph, while she, pointing toward the right in her picture plane, is now
seemingly pointing into the depth of her mysterious landscape ... Did Leonardo
dare give us a glimpse into the beyond? and if so, could he have painted
Elysium or paradise in bright daylight? No, certainly not. He would have rendered
that landscape no one ever saw in a hazy manner, veiled by layers of deep air,
so that one will more guess than actually see (have a look at Leonardo's Nymph
drawing at Windsor: you have to guess about the landscape, more than you can
really see). How could Leonardo possibly have obtained such an effect? By
covering his hypothetical and probably never carried out Nymph painting with a
special varnish. What we know for sure is that he got a commission from the
Pope, but instead of drawing and painting he began experimenting with all kinds
of varnishes, whereupon the Pope exclaimed in despair: This man will never
complete anything, because he begins with the end.
